Decadent Theatre Company Brings THE PILLOWMAN to the Everyman Theatre

By: Nov. 01, 2016

Decadent Theatre Company, in association with the Arts Council and the Arts Council of Northern Ireland, bring their successful second national tour of Martin McDonagh's award winning, The Pillowman, to the Everyman stage, from Monday 7th - Friday 11th November.

The Pillowman opens in a prison cell where a young writer, Katurian, is being questioned about the children's tales he has written - grim tales, which have inspired copycat killings in the streets outside. Mixing comedy and dread, two interrogators tease out the resemblance between real and fictional worlds while probing the personal responsibility of the writer and his brother. Winner of two Tony Awards and Olivier Award for Best New Play, The Pillowman takes you on a ride through a comedic yet alarming interrogation and through the fantastical tales told by the young writer. The laughter provoked by McDonagh's gift for black comedy never overrides the emotions of fear and pity. The storytelling skill in The Pillowman will keep you on the edge of your seat to the very last line.

The production features the wonderful dramatic talents of Peter Gowen as Tupolski, Diarmuid Noyes as Katurian, Owen Sharpe as Michal, and Gary Lydon who will reprise his critically acclaimed role as Ariel. The show is directed by Andrew Flynn, with an award winning creative team consisting Owen MacCarthaigh (set design), Carl Kennedy (sound design), Ciaran Bagnall (lighting design) and Petra Breathnach (costume design).
